Writing a Function Rule from a Situation
Don’t forget about DEPENDENT VARIABLE and INDEPENDENT VARIABLE!
“________________” depends on “________________”
Examples:
a) On Anna’s wall there is a painting of a rabbit. The rabbit in the painting
is 5 times the size of a normal rabbit. Write a function rule f(n) to
describe this relationship, where n represents the size of a normal rabbit.
b) Suppose you borrow money from a relative to buy a lawn mower that
costs $245. You charge $18 to mow a lawn. Write a rule f(m) to describe
your profit as a function of the number of lawns mowed, m.
c) Melanie gets paid $19 per hour. Write a rule f(h) to describe her income as
a function of the number of hours, h, she works.
